Standard Signal Mode Table Model Name Synchronization (PANEL Spec) Resolution Horizontal Frequency Vertical Frequency Optimum Resolution Maximum Resolution S19A330NH*/S19A332NH*/S19A334NH*/S19A336NH*/ S19A338NH* 30 - 81 kHz 56 - 75 Hz (VGA) 50 - 75 Hz (HDMI) 1366x 768 @ 60 Hz 1366x 768 @ 60 Hz S22A330NH*/S22A332NH*/S22A334NH*/S22A336NH*/ S22A338NH* 30 - 81 kHz 56 - 75 Hz (VGA) 50 - 75 Hz (HDMI) 1920 x 1080 @ 60 Hz 1920 x 1080 @ 60 Hz If a signal that belongs to the following standard signal modes is transmitted from your PC, the screen will automatically be adjusted. If the signal transmitted from the PC does not belong to the standard signal modes, the screen may be blank even though the power LED turns on. In such a case, change the settings according to the following table by referring to the graphics card user manual.
